How do i find lost shares in australia?
Answers: What do you mean with "lost shares"?
If you mean - the share registry has lost contact with you, you may want to contact the share registry and update your contact details. The two biggest share registries in Australia are Computer Share and Link Market. Check out their websites for their phone number www.computershare.com.au and www.linkmarketservices.com.au.
If you mean - you lost track of what happened to your shares - they "disappeared" from the news - you can go to www.delisted.com.au to see what happened. But then, you still have to contact the share registry (to update your details, to see maybe there is an unclaimed money from some takeover, etc etc possibilities).
When ringing the two Share Registries - just bear with their call centre people. If you are lucky, they are really great. If not, they can be really unhelpful.
